#8a1238 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#8a1238 is composed of 54.1% red, 7.1% green and 22%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 87% magenta, 59.4% yellow and 45.9% black. It has a hue angle of 341 degrees, a saturation of 76.9% and a lightness of 30.6%. #8a1238 color hex could be obtained by blending #ff2470 with #150000. Closest websafe color is: #990033.

● #8a1238 color description : Dark pink.
#8a1238 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#8a1238 has RGB values of R:138, G:18, B:56 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.87, Y:0.59, K:0.46. Its decimal value is 9048632.
